The Ministry of Works and Housing has received financing from the World Bank toward the cost of the Greater Accra Climate Resilient and Integrated Development Project, and intends to apply part of the proceeds toward payments under the contract for Dredging of the Odaw River Main Channel and Selected Tributaries and clearing under a Performance Based Contract. The procurement process will be governed by the World Bank’s Procurement Regulations.
The Government of Ghana intends to initially select Applicants for Deferred and Routine Maintenance Dredging of the Odaw Drainage Basin in Accra under a Performance Based Contract. The contract has a duration of four and a half years, split in one or two years of deferred maintenance dredging and three or four years of routine maintenance dredging. The geographical scope of the contract includes the Odaw river from Caprice to the sea (comprising lined and unlined sections), and the main Odaw River tributaries (the South Kaneshie, Cemetery and Mataheko drains, the first section of the Nima drain, the Agbogbloshie drain and the Odawna drain). The dredging works will be procured under a Performance Based Contract (PBC). Applicants must show proof of experience in urban dredging/dredging of drainage channels/dredging of shallow channels/dredging in environmentally environmental sensitive areas to be initially selected. Experience in PBC will be an added advantage. It is expected that the Request for Proposals will be made in May 2021.
